Job description

The Health Checkup Coordinator is responsible for managing and coordinating patient health screening services, ensuring a seamless and efficient experience for patients and corporate clients. The role involves appointment coordination, patient communication, coordination with clinical departments, and ensuring timely completion of health checkup processes in line with hospital standards and quality requirements.

Responsibilities
  • Coordinate end-to-end health checkup appointments for individual patients and corporate health screening programs.
  • Contact patients/clients to schedule appointments, provide pre-checkup instructions, and confirm attendance.
  • Welcome and guide patients throughout the health checkup journey, ensuring excellent patient experience.
  • Register patients accurately and verify required documents and information.
  • Coordinate with physicians, nursing teams, laboratory, radiology, and other departments to ensure smooth patient flow.
  • Monitor the progress of health checkup activities and ensure all required investigations are completed.
  • Address patient queries, provide accurate information regarding health screening packages, and escalate concerns when required.
  • Ensure timely follow-up for pending reports, consultations, and completion of health assessment results.
  • Maintain accurate patient records and ensure confidentiality of medical information.
  • Support corporate clients by coordinating group health screening schedules and requirements.
  • Prepare and maintain daily/monthly reports related to appointments, patient volumes, and service performance.
  • Ensure compliance with hospital policies, DHA regulations, quality standards, and patient safety guidelines.
  • Contribute to improving patient satisfaction and operational efficiency within the health checkup unit.
Qualifications & Experience
  • Bachelor’s degree or diploma in Healthcare Administration, Nursing, Business Administration, or a related field preferred.
  • Minimum 2–3 years of experience in healthcare coordination, patient services, medical administration, or executive health screening.
  • Experience working in a hospital or healthcare facility in the UAE is preferred.
  • Knowledge of healthcare processes, patient registration, and medical terminology.
  • Experience handling corporate clients and health screening programs is an advantage.
